Current Market Status
The vehicle security system market includes a range of products designed to protect vehicles from theft, unauthorized access, and vandalism. Key components such as immobilizers, alarms, GPS tracking systems, and advanced keyless entry solutions are being increasingly integrated into new vehicle models.
The market is expanding as vehicle theft rates continue to rise, consumer demand for enhanced security features grows, and vehicle manufacturers seek to comply with increasingly stringent safety regulations. For instance, in 2024, the automotive industry saw substantial adoption of biometric access control systems and connected car solutions, which are driving the demand for more advanced security technologies.
List of Emerging Opportunities
- Opportunity 1: Biometric technologies, such as fingerprint and facial recognition, are gaining traction in vehicle security systems. These technologies offer a higher level of personalization and security, reducing the risk of unauthorized access. The adoption of biometric access is expected to grow rapidly as consumers increasingly seek more secure and convenient methods to access their vehicles.
- Opportunity 2: The rise of connected vehicles presents opportunities for integrating security systems with IoT (Internet of Things) platforms. This integration allows for real-time monitoring, remote diagnostics, and enhanced security features, including advanced theft prevention systems. The global vehicle access control market, which includes connected car technologies, was valued at $15.53 billion in 2024, and this figure is expected to rise significantly over the next few years
- Opportunity 3: As vehicles become more connected and autonomous, the need for robust cybersecurity measures is critical. The automotive cybersecurity market was valued at $2.77 billion in 2024 and is expected to grow in 2025, as cybersecurity continues to be a primary concern for automakers and consumers. These solutions are essential in protecting vehicles from cyberattacks that target sensitive vehicle control systems.
- Opportunity 4: The introduction of a universal "Plug and Charge" protocol for electric vehicles is set to streamline the charging process, making EV ownership more convenient and secure. As the adoption of EVs continues to grow, the integration of advanced security systems for EVs will also rise, presenting a new market opportunity for security solutions tailored for electric vehicles.
- Opportunity 5: Integrating vehicle security systems with ADAS can provide enhanced safety features, such as collision avoidance and lane-keeping assistance, which complement traditional security systems. This not only improves vehicle security but also offers a competitive edge in the automotive market as more manufacturers seek to include ADAS in their vehicles.
Barriers to Entry
Entering the vehicle security system market presents several challenges:
- High Development Costs: Developing advanced security technologies requires significant investment in research and development to stay ahead of competitors.
- Regulatory Compliance: Manufacturers must adhere to stringent safety and data protection regulations that differ across regions, which can complicate product design and distribution.
- Technological Integration: Integrating new security features into existing vehicle systems demands significant expertise, which can be a barrier for smaller firms looking to enter the market.
